Djibouti Food. But let's move past the unusual name… to the unusual food situation. It is a porridge prepared by soaking oats in milk, and is flavored with cumin or other spices. Djibouti's cuisine is heavily influenced by its neighbors, ethiopia, somalia and yemen, as well as its former occupier france, and by india to some extent. According to doctor's without borders, less than 1/2 of 1 percent of the small, arid landscape can be farmed. Dining out is enjoyable, but expensive and djibouti city is known for its pricey restaurants. Despite recent economic growth, poverty rates stand at 79 percent, with 42 percent of as a result, djibouti imports 90 percent of the food it needs, which makes it highly dependent on international market prices. In djibouti, banana fritters are made with mashed ripe bananas mixed in a batter of flour, sugary water, and a dash of nutmeg. Being a hotspot on the old spice road that made its way to timbuktu, the country has a range of dishes that are as unique as their origin. Garoobey is one of the staple dishes of djibouti.
